We simply call it “church,” although its full name is “Cerkev Marijinega vnebovzetja” or “Church of the Assumption of Mary.” But that’s nothing unusual, all churches are dedicated to different saints or to Mary, etc., yet people rarely refer to them by their full names in everyday conversation.
To the general public it’s basically known as “the (or that) church on Lake Bled”… I mean… it’s a church, it’s on the lake (technically on an island, of course)… Why complicate?
